JDR Recruitment are recruiting for an experienced Press Brake Operator to work at an Engineering company based in Bolton.
Summary: Operate press brake machinery to manufacture metal components by bending and forming sheet metal to required dimensions, quality standards, and production schedules.
Key Responsibilities
- Set up and operate press brake machines.
- Read and interpret blueprints, drawings, and work orders.
- Select appropriate tooling, dies, and machine settings.
- Measure and inspect finished parts using gauges, callipers, and other measuring tools.
- Adjust machine settings to maintain product quality and accuracy.
- Perform routine machine maintenance and cleaning.
- Follow workplace safety procedures and company policies.
- Record production data and report any equipment or quality issues.
Required Skills
- Ability to read technical drawings and specifications.
- Basic knowledge of metal fabrication and forming processes.
- Experience using measuring instruments such as callipers and micrometres.
- Strong attention to detail and quality control.
- Good mathematical and problem-solving skills.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Working hours: 7:30am-16:30pm Monday to Thursday and 7:30am-13:30pm Friday. Temporary to Permanent after 12 weeks.
